Understanding O1 Visa Eligibility

Before diving into ways to improve your eligibility, it’s essential to understand the basic requirements for an  O1 visa eligibility. The United States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) outlines specific criteria for demonstrating extraordinary ability. To qualify, you must either:

Provide evidence of receiving a major internationally recognized award, such as a Nobel Prize, or

Meet at least three of the following criteria:

  • Receipt of nationally or internationally recognized awards or prizes for excellence in your field.
  • Membership in associations that require outstanding achievements of their members.
  • Published material about you in professional or major trade publications.
  • Participation as a judge of the work of others in your field.
  • Significant original contributions to your field.
  • Authorship of scholarly articles.
  • Employment in a critical capacity for organizations with a distinguished reputation.
  • A high salary or remuneration compared to others in your field.
  • Commercial success in the performing arts.

By meeting the USCIS standards, you demonstrate that your skills and accomplishments set you apart from others in your industry.

Build A Strong Portfolio Of Achievements

One of the most effective ways to improve your chances of meeting O1 visa eligibility is by systematically building a portfolio that showcases your extraordinary abilities. Here are some tips:

  • Document Awards and Recognitions: Keep detailed records of any awards, honors, or prizes you’ve received in your career. Even if they don’t seem significant, they may add value when presented as part of a broader narrative.
  • Highlight Professional Memberships: Join associations and organizations that recognize excellence in your field. Ensure these memberships have stringent eligibility criteria.
  • Compile Evidence of Media Coverage: Collect articles, interviews, or profiles about you in reputable media outlets. This demonstrates your prominence and influence in your industry.

Publish Original Work

Publishing original work is a crucial element of O1 visa eligibility, particularly for individuals in academic, scientific, or creative fields. Focus on the following:

  • Write Scholarly Articles: Aim to publish research papers, essays, or articles in respected journals or industry-specific publications.
  • Contribute to Books or Industry Standards: If possible, author or co-author books or contribute to widely recognized industry standards.
  • Leverage Digital Platforms: For creative professionals, publishing work online can serve as evidence of your contributions and influence.

Gain Peer Recognition

Recognition from peers and industry experts can significantly enhance your O1 visa application. To achieve this:

  • Participate as a Judge: Seek opportunities to serve as a judge or panelist for awards, competitions, or evaluations in your field.
  • Obtain Recommendation Letters: Secure letters of recommendation from respected professionals who can vouch for your extraordinary abilities. These letters should highlight your specific contributions and their impact on the field.
  • Network with Industry Leaders: Build relationships with prominent figures in your industry who can support your case.

Demonstrate Original Contributions

Original contributions to your field are a key factor in meeting O1 visa eligibility. To strengthen this aspect:

  • Pursue Innovative Projects: Work on projects that solve significant problems, introduce new concepts, or advance your field.
  • File for Patents: If applicable, file for patents to demonstrate innovation and originality.
  • Showcase Impact: Provide detailed evidence of how your contributions have influenced your field or benefitted others.

Understand Common Challenges

Many applicants face challenges during the O1 visa process. By being aware of these issues, you can take proactive steps to address them:

  • Insufficient Evidence: Ensure your evidence is robust and directly addresses the eligibility criteria.
  • Lack of Documentation: Maintain detailed records of your accomplishments to avoid scrambling for evidence during the application process.
  • Poorly Written Recommendation Letters: Work with recommenders to craft strong, detailed letters that highlight your qualifications.
